Output 3c7cc6149ce60a65c43f3b4d7dc75a6866b22d8c439ba70c676dc7365594195d:21

value
696662
script pubkey
OP_0 OP_PUSHBYTES_20 afda29d6eeaedd028447bab5a2c2390949138ac3
address
bc1q4ldzn4hw4mws9pz8h2669s3ep9y38zkrkyvc5w
transaction
3c7cc6149ce60a65c43f3b4d7dc75a6866b22d8c439ba70c676dc7365594195d
spent
true